Ulaanbaatar Symbol and Population PDF Print E-mail
ImageThe legendary bird - Geruda has been chosen as the emblem of the Mongolian capital. According to Mongolian beliefs, the Geruda symbolizes courage and honesty. On the forehead of the Geruda are the Soyombo symbols, which are also found on the national flag of Mongolia.

Mongolian Horses PDF Print E-mail

ImageThere is some scientific supposion that horses originated in Mongolia. The ancestor of hoofed animals — toe-nailed animals (condylarter) was found in 1924 in Mongolia by Andrew's expedition. Later, international expeditions have found proof of these suppositions in Mongolian territory and have made a comparative research.

Cashmere Processing PDF Print E-mail

ImageIn Mongolia, herders hand comb goats in the spring, when the goats begin to naturally shed their cashmere undercoat. For first combing, cashmere is usually only harvested from the neck and belly of the goat, leaving the body covered for warmth. The herder will comb the same goats again as the weather warms, continuing to collect cashmere as the goats shed.

Oil PDF Print E-mail

ImageThe oil sector has a high potential for exploration activity and large-scale investment is required. A total of 22 contract fields, covering 538,000 square kilometres in Mongolia's territory were se­lected. Now American, Australian and Chinese oil companies are running their activities on six contract fields under a Production Sharing Contract concluded with the Government of Mongolia.

Mongol Empire Map PDF Print E-mail

In 1206, the year of the Tiger, Temuujin managed to unite the Merkits, Naimans, Mongols, Uighurs, Keraits, Tatars and disparate other smaller tribes under his rule through his charisma, dedication, and strong will. An Ikh Khurildai  (Great Council) was announced near the Onon River, by proudly raising the state flag.

Canada to open trade office in Ulaanbaatar

Canada will open a permanent trade office in Mongolia to assist local Canadian businesses. Canadian firms have a reported $395 million in investments, including operating more than 20 mines. Canada is also Mongolia’s second largest investor.
